Peer reviewedHiggs, W. J.; Joseph, Karen B. – Journal of Social Psychology, 1971
In an extension of an early social facilitation study, 80 female college students reproduced a partially learned Indian folktale before both large and small audiences. Subjects showed greater verbal production but less accuracy before the large audiences. (Author)

Peer reviewedKotler, Philip – American Behavioral Scientist, 1971
A framework involving five elements--cause, change agent, change target, channel, and change strategy--provides a useful framework for social action analysis. (Author)

Peer reviewedWarren, Donald I. – Sociology of Education, 1970
Four mechanisms of social control are analyzed in relationship to a typology of school staffs which in several respects resemble primary groups. Findings suggest the co-variation of structures of colleague relations and colleague social controls in elementary schools. (Author)
